引言
在数字经济时代,区块链技术的迅猛发展使得区块链钱包成为了用户管理和存储数字资产的重要工具。然而,随着区块链钱包的广泛应用,各种技术风险逐渐浮现,可能对用户的资产安全造成威胁。本文将对区块链钱包的技术风险进行深入分析,以帮助用户更好地理解和防范潜在风险。
区块链钱包的基本概述
区块链钱包是用于存储和管理加密货币(如比特币、以太坊等)的一种软件工具或硬件设备。它通过生成和管理私钥的方式来确保用户对资产的控制。区块链钱包的类型主要包括热钱包和冷钱包,其中热钱包在线上,方便快捷,但安全性相对较低;而冷钱包离线保存,安全性较高,但使用上不够便捷。
区块链钱包的技术风险分类
区块链钱包的技术风险可以大致分为以下几类:
- 私钥泄露风险:私钥是控制数字资产的关键,若被黑客获取,用户的资产将面临被盗的风险。
- 软件漏洞风险:钱包软件可能存在未修复的漏洞,一旦被利用,将导致用户资产被盗。
- 中心化服务风险:使用第三方服务的钱包可能会面临服务中心化导致的单点故障风险。
- 恶意软件风险:用户的设备被恶意软件感染,可能会导致信息泄露和资产盗取。
- 网络攻击风险:各种网络攻击手段(如钓鱼攻击、DDoS攻击等)都可能直接影响区块链钱包的安全性。
私钥的安全性如何保障?
私钥是每个区块链钱包的核心组成部分,是用户管理数字资产的唯一凭证。因此,私钥的安全性至关重要。为了保障私钥的安全,用户可以采取以下措施:
- 使用硬件钱包:硬件钱包可以有效离线存储私钥,将其与互联网隔离,从而防止网络攻击和恶意软件的影响。
- 启用多重签名:通过配置多重签名功能,即使攻击者获得了一部分钥匙,仍需其他签名才能完成交易,增强安全性。
- 定期备份:用户应定期备份私钥和助记词,并妥善保管备份,避免因设备丢失而造成资产无法访问。
- 避免在公用设备上使用:尽量避免在公共Wi-Fi或公用计算机上访问钱包,降低被黑客攻击的风险。
如何识别和防范软件漏洞?
软件漏洞是区块链钱包面临的主要技术风险之一。为了识别和防范软件漏洞,用户可以采取以下措施:
- 使用知名钱包:选择知名开发团队发布的钱包,通常经过安全审计和漏洞测试,安全性较高。
- 定期更新:定期检查并更新钱包软件,开发者会发布更新版本修复已知漏洞,保持软件在最新状态。
- 关注社区反馈:参与钱包相关社区,关注用户反馈和问题讨论,及时获取发现的新风险信息。
- 使用开源钱包:开源钱包的代码可以被多人审核,社区更易于发现潜在漏洞。
中心化服务对区块链钱包的影响是什么?
许多用户在使用区块链钱包时往往依赖于中心化的服务提供商。这种方式虽然便捷,但也带来了中心化服务风险:
- 单点故障:如果中心化服务出现故障,用户将无法访问或管理自己的资产,这种情况在中心化交易平台尤为常见。
- 数据泄露:中心化服务存储了大量用户数据,一旦遭受攻击,用户的隐私和资产有可能被盗取。
- 依赖性风险:用户资产的安全性完全依赖于服务商的管理,如果服务商选择关闭或遭遇法律问题,用户资产可能会面临风险。
为了规避这些风险,建议用户使用去中心化钱包,确保对私钥和资产的完全控制。
如何防范恶意软件造成的风险?
恶意软件是影响用户区块链钱包安全的又一重要因素。以下是防范恶意软件的几种策略:
- 安装抗病毒软件:使用权威的抗病毒软件定期检测计算机和移动设备,防止恶意软件入侵。
- 避免点击可疑链接:在访问钱包或交易所时,确保网址正确,避免随意点击不明链接,防止钓鱼攻击。
- 使用虚拟私人网络(VPN):当连接到公共网络时,使用VPN保护网络传输安全,防止数据被窃取。
- 定期清理设备:清理和检查设备中不明的应用程序,卸载不必要的软件,减少风险暴露。
怎样应对网络攻击?
网络攻击是区块链钱包面临的重大威胁之一,保护钱包免受攻击的策略包括:
- 增强密码安全:使用复杂且独特的密码,并定期更换,避免使用易被猜测的信息。
- 启用双因素认证(2FA):使用双因素认证增加安全层级,即使密码被盗,攻击者仍需额外身份验证才能访问账户。
- 关注网络安全事件:保持对网络安全事件的关注,及时调整安全措施,应对新出现的攻击手段。
- 教育与意识提升:定期接受安全知识培训,增强自身和团队的网络安全意识,减少人为错误造成的风险。
结论
区块链钱包作为管理数字资产的重要工具,面临多种技术风险。用户有必要深入了解这些风险并采取相应的防范措施,以确保自己的资产安全。通过选择安全的存储方式、保持软件更新、增强密码和身份验证等方式,用户可以有效降低技术风险,保护自己的数字财富。
以上内容提供了对区块链钱包技术风险的全面分析和应对建议,希望能对读者在使用区块链钱包的过程中带来帮助,提升数字资产的安全性。